Other children may develop normally for the first few months or years of life, but then suddenly become withdrawn or aggressive or lose language skills they've already acquired. These conditions are now all called autism spectrum disorder. ASD begins before the age of 3 and last throughout a person’s life, although symptoms may improve over time. Some children with ASD show hints of future problems within the first few months of life. In others, symptoms may not show up until 24 months or later. Autism expresses itself through a spectrum of symptoms. Autism spectrum disorder (ASD) appears in infancy and early childhood, causing delays in many basic areas of development, such as learning to talk, play, and interact with others.

2017-10-02 · What are the symptoms of autism in toddlers? Some of the typical signs of autism in children between 18-24 months are: Your toddler doesn’t want to be around other children; Your toddler struggles to share toys or interests with other children; Your toddler is overly aggressive; Your toddler has no interest in imaginative play such as dressing up Level 2 Autism Checklists for Toddlers Level 2 autism screening checklists, usually used for toddlers who have a positive Level 1 autism checklist, are also available.
